
UC Riverside Falls to #21 UCLA Bruins in First of Three-Game Set
2/25/2022 9:25:00 PM | Baseball
LOS ANGELES, Calif. - The University of California, Riverside (UCR) Highlanders kicked off a three-game set against the #21 UCLA Bruins at 6 PM. This matchup, the first between the two teams since Feb 16, 2020, also takes place on the road at Jackie Robinson Stadium.Â
Â
Outstanding pitching held the Bruins to just three runs on the opening night of the series.
Â
Zach Jacobs pitched 3.2 innings, letting up two runs on three hits and striking out five Bruins. He was relieved in the fourth inning by Eric Marrujo, who threw three innings with one run on one hit and four strikeouts. Sergio Ramirez closed out the game for the Highlanders on the mound, pitching the final inning and letting up no runs or hits and striking out two.
Â
UC Riverside let up just two runs in the third inning and extended their lead with a Bruin run sent home in the seventh. It wasn't until the eighth inning that the Highlanders broke onto the scoreboard, with Sean McLeod roping the RBI single to right field to send Joey Nicolai home, cutting UCLA's lead 3-1.
Â
Nicolai went two for three at the plate, leading his team offensively with his two hits. Additionally, Andrew Rivas, Ely Stuart and McLeod each recorded a hit in the game.
Â
The Highlanders return for game two, tomorrow, Saturday, February 26 with the first pitch scheduled for 2:00 PM.
